Roof Lifespan by Material — Surrey BC Climate
| Roofing Material | Expected Lifespan (Surrey BC) | Key Factors |
|---|---|---|
| 3-tab asphalt shingles | 15–20 years | Lower wind rating, thinner profile |
| Architectural (laminate) shingles | 22–28 years | IKO Cambridge, GAF Timberline HD — most common in Surrey |
| Premium asphalt (Class 4 impact) | 28–35 years | Hail resistance, algae resistance built in |
| Cedar shake | 20–30 years | Requires treatment every 5 years; moss is a major enemy in Surrey |
| Metal (standing seam or exposed fastener) | 40–70 years | Lifetime material if installed correctly; higher upfront cost |
| Concrete or clay tile | 40–50 years | Heavy — not all Surrey homes have adequate structural support |
| Torch-on / modified bitumen (flat) | 15–20 years | Quality of installation is the primary lifespan driver |
| TPO membrane (flat) | 20–30 years | Heat-welded seams are critical — no shortcuts |
Why Surrey BC’s Climate Shortens Roof Life
Surrey gets approximately 1,200 mm of rainfall per year — nearly twice the Canadian average. Combined with prolonged wet periods (October–March), moss and algae have ideal growing conditions. A roof that performs well for 25 years in Toronto may only last 18–20 years in Surrey without annual maintenance.
The biggest lifespan killers in Surrey: moss growth (holds moisture against shingles), inadequate attic ventilation (heat buildup degrades shingles from below), and blocked gutters (water backs up at the eave).
How To Extend Your Roof’s Life in Surrey BC
- Annual inspection — catch lifted flashings, cracked shingles, and early moss before they become major failures. A $300–$500 inspection prevents a $12,000 emergency.
- Moss treatment every 3–4 years — zinc strips at the ridge + chemical treatment when coverage exceeds 10%
- Keep gutters clear — twice a year minimum in Surrey (fall + spring)
- Ensure proper attic ventilation — check that ridge and soffit vents are unobstructed
- Address flashings immediately — a cracked chimney flashing is a $400 repair; deferred, it becomes a $5,000 interior damage claim
When It’s Time to Replace vs. Repair
If your asphalt shingle roof is under 15 years old and less than 25% of the shingles are damaged, targeted repairs are usually cost-effective.
